Today we had to present a selection of the music videos we had chosen as a group to the class, whilst the other group were presenting we had to think about potential ideas for that music video. We also told the other group which song we thought had the most potential. The feedback we got from the other group was:

Ed Sheeran - Drunk
For this song we all came up with the idea of flashbacks of a possible night before or a stressed businessman who has got drunk and we would film some of the things he gets up to when his drunk. There was also the idea of it being filmed in black and white as some members felt this suited the song better, we also got the idea that some of it could be shot as in its from a CCTV camera. Due to the rhythm of the song we felt the camera would constantly have to keep moving so there would be 360 degree shots. there was also an idea of possibly making the entire video or parts of it backwards, to portray reflection. The final idea is that we could add some performace to the video as the artist sitting in the background or foreground playing a guitar.

Pegasus Bridge - Skinny
The feedback for this song was the idea of the artist almost constantly following/looking/admiring a girl that he likes, this will then include close ups of the artist and in the background the women in different locations. Then there was also the idea that the artist could be invisible to the women.

Soul - Express Yourself
This song had one of the most positive feedbacks, we all came up with the idea of the artist being in different locations (possibly london) and walking up to random people with an "express yourself" sign the person would then react to this. The viewers would never get to see the sign until the end of the song. There was also an idea of almost like a pied piper theme where everyone would follow this character holding an "express yourself" sign, giving this happy and jolly atmosphere which matches the song.

Lucy Rose - Bikes
The last video also had very possitive feedback we came up with the idea of going on like a daytrip to a location but filming it in lots of different places e.g. lighthouse, sea, in the car etc. In the video there would be a big group of friends all on this day out enjoying themselves doing different things depending on what location they were at. Another option was instead of the beach was a fairground again the same principle of a group of friends going out. Some people felt the video should be very colourful and lively but also make the video go through the times e.g. at the start of the video be early in the morning and then at the end it to be at night. Although it may not give the same uplifting feel if we film it in October as aposed to during the summer months.
